Transaction 8930c7537ad4bd42d1708cd2b2358a4864165691599f84d42251a83a0d960091
1 Input
1 Output
-
8930c7537ad4bd42d1708cd2b2358a4864165691599f84d42251a83a0d960091:0
- value
- 109226
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 59b72b99511865cc3b92cdb71ad3213847e84eff OP_EQUAL
- address
- 39sPVWhHJu5oDSxqHxad8qzQdWWJ64WowZ